In summary, a mathematician's love for physics can certainly lead to a successful career. The two fields are closely related and many mathematical concepts are essential in understanding and solving problems in physics. This combination of skills can open up opportunities in areas such as research, data analysis, and engineering. Additionally, a strong foundation in mathematics can make it easier to learn and apply complex theories in physics, making a mathematician well-equipped for a successful career in this field.
